      <description>&lt;P&gt;I just started implementing react-accept.js as a solution using the Hosted Payment form.&amp;nbsp; I'm able to trigger the modal and collect the credit card info and the API is returning the correct data object as per the documentation.&amp;nbsp; But... what do I have to do to actually charge the card an amount?&amp;nbsp; I don't see anything in the documentation where I can send up a dollar amount using the Hosted Payment form response object?&amp;nbsp; Is there a way to add a transaction amount to the submission?&amp;nbsp; Do I have to make an additional call with the payment amount in the submission handler?&amp;nbsp; (And if so, what is the endpoint and what should the payload be?)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I've looked at the documentation but all I'm seeing is server-based solutions... Is there a way to submit a payment directly from a React app?&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
